Bristol Food Network C.I.C is looking for a volunteer or volunteers to help with Communications, ideally someone who can commit half a day to a day a week for at least a month. BFN supports, informs and connects individuals, community projects, organisations and businesses who share a vision to transform Bristol into a sustainable food city. You could be working on core Bristol Food Network Communications or on ‘Bristol Good Food 2030’ which is soon to launch, an integrated food system transformation action plan which will engage with multiple partners across the city in order to deliver on the food-related targets of the One City Plan; Climate & Ecological Emergency Strategies; and the emerging Food Equality Strategy. This work will provide exposure to a huge range of organisations across the city, with opportunities to make new connections and understand how different elements of the city’s food system work together.

There are lots of varied tasks we need help with and, depending on your experience, we can tailor the work to what you might be interested in helping with and learning about. This could include helping to write Comms material, updating resources, photography, events, and social media content and planning. We’d particularly love to hear from any whizzes at Excel to help us manage data.
